      Associate Principal Scientist - Process Analytical technology

      Location - Macclesfield, UK


      Join our team as an Associate Principal Scientist for Process Analytical Technology (PAT) and make a significant impact in the development and manufacture of Active Pharmaceutical Ingredients (APIs). As a specialist in PAT for New Modalities, you will drive technical excellence amongst our scientists, enabling them to identify and implement PAT in the development and manufacture of APIs. This role is an opportunity to be a leader in PAT and a role model for people, skills, and communication.


      As an Associate Principal Scientist, you will be a recognized technical expert in the development and application of PAT solutions during the development and manufacture of drug substances. You will execute organizational ECS, sustainability, and productivity targets in the area of PAT and New Modalities. You will collaborate with external manufacturers in the development and application of PAT into commercial manufacturing plants. You will also build and utilize an internal and external network to review and evaluate new trends in PAT applications.

      Essential Skills/Experience:
      - A minimum of a PhD or degree level education in a relevant scientific discipline with significant experience in applying PAT and associated data processing expertise within a Research & Development environment in the pharmaceutical industry.
      - Knowledge of Control Strategies, especially involving the implementation of spectroscopic methods.
      - Demonstrated success proposing and developing PAT-based solutions.
      - A thorough understanding of the principles and management of SHE and cGMP.
      - Ability to think and operate across functional boundaries, constructively challenge the status quo and continually seek opportunities for novel work practices.
      - Experience supporting external collaborations in the development of new technologies.
      - An established track record of enhancing business reputation through scientific publications on PAT.

      Desirable Skills/Experience:
      - Practical experience working on solid phase synthesis platforms such oligonucleotide or peptide chemical syntheses.
      - Interest in the use of automation and closed-loop control in API manufacturing.
      - Appreciation of Data Science, and coding skills in Matlab or Python.
